We have an Win2008R2 SP1 Server with an Directory F:\test, this Directory is a networkshare, inside the Directory are some Directories linked as DFS-Share to another Server.

When we access the this DFS-Shares with an SAMBA Share from Linux, there is an confuse behaviour.

We can Access the Networkshare on the Windows 2008 Server, but when we try to acces the Directory which was linked with DFS to another Server, an we try to
make the comand ls* - we receive the following info.

"ls:Lese Verzeichnis.:Das Object is remote"

and nothing is show in this Directory. But when we go one step back with cd.. and than on step for to the same directory, then we can show the files and folders in this DFS-Share.

We changed the loggin from mount.cifs to an higher level, and then the following error is shown in dmesg.

fs/cifs/transport.c: Sending smb: total_len 140
fs/cifs/connect.c: rfc1002 length 0x27
fs/cifs/connect.c: invalid transact2 word count
Status code returned 0xc0000257 NT_STATUS_PATH_NOT_COVERED
fs/cifs/netmisc.c: Mapping smb error code 3 to POSIX err -66


Has anybody experience with this problem?

If you aren't already using them, you will have more luck with the samba3x-* series of packages on CentOS 5 than with the ordinary samba-* ones. They're complete replacements for the old samba 3.0.33 packages which need to be completely uninstalled and the new samba3x-* ones installed. These will give you 3.5.10 and stand a much better chance of working with newer versions of Windows.

Searching on that error message got me a redhat bugzilla entry for Fedora 14 but that one ends up with a server misconfiguration it seems. https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=682829

There are quite a few other hits on google when searching for "Status code returned 0xc0000257 NT_STATUS_PATH_NOT_COVERED" but none of them seemed to have an immediate solution but could be worth a read anyway since they may have some hints you can explore.
